Air at 200 kPa enters a 2-m-Iong, thin-walled tube of 25-mm diameter at 150°C and 6 m/s Steam at 20 bars condenses on the outer surface.
(a) Determine the outlet temperature and pressure drop of the air, as well as the rate of heat transfer to the air.
(b) Calculate the parameters of part (a) if the pressure of the air is doubled.
